Default Shutter Island - Discuss the Shutter Island Movie

Shutter Island is directed by Martin Scorsese, and it stars Leonardo DiCaprio, Emily Mortimer and Mark Ruffalo. Mortimer plays a psychotic killer (Mortimer) who somehow disappears from a mental institution on Shutter Island. This prompts a pair of U.S. Marshals (Ruffalo and DiCaprio) to visit the facility in order to track her down, but all is not as it seems.

It opens on February 19th, 2010. Chime in when you've seen it.
